摘 要:目的观察防已黄芪汤对兔肺缺血再灌注损伤的保护作用。方法将36只日本大耳白兔随机分为3组,每组12只,A组为对照组,B组为黄芪汤组,C组为防已黄芪汤组。制备兔在体肺缺血再灌注损伤模型。恢复灌注后4h(W4)、6h(T6)检测各组血清c反应蛋白(CaP)、超氧化物歧化酶(SOD)、丙二醛(MDA)和白细胞介素-6(IL-6)水平。结果T4、T6时段,SOD(B组:119.52±11.23、123.40±12.15;C组:125.34±12.56、129.38±11.54)较A组增加;MDA(B组:2.91±0.46、2.53±0.35、C组:2.85±0.32、2.56±0.24)、CRP(B组:2.89±0.17、2.37±0.13;C组:2.57±0.12、2.10±0.11)、IL-6(B组:697.24±47.62、654.35±37.21;C组:662.63±45.67、612.54±39.72)较A组均下降,差异有统计学意义(P〈0.01);C组较B组MDA、SOD差异无统计学意义(P〉0.05),CRP、IL-6明显改善(P〈0.05)。结论防已黄芪汤能明显减轻兔肺缺血再灌注损伤,其作用机制可能与抗氧化、清除氧自由基及降低全身炎症反应有关。Objective To study the pretective effect of the Fangji-Huangqi decoction on lung ischemia-reperfusion injury (IRI). Methods Thirty-six Japanese rabbits were randomly divided into three groups: IRI group (group A), Huangqi decoction group (group B) and Fangji-Huangqi decoction group ( group C). Rabbit lung IRI model was established in vivo. The C-reactive protein ( CRP), superoxide dismutase ( SOD), malondialdehyde (MDA) and interleukin (IL) -6 of serum were determined at 4th ( T4 ) and 6th h (T6) after reperfusion. Results At T4 and T6, as compared with group A, SOD levels ( B : 119. 52 ± 11.23, 123.40± 12. 15 ; C : 125.34 ± 12. 56, 129. 38 ± 11.54) were higher, while MDA levels (B: 2.91 ±0.46, 2. 53 ±0. 35; C: 2. 85 ±0. 32, 2. 56 ±0. 24), CRP levels (B: 2. 89 ±0. 17, 2. 37 ± 0.13; C: 2.57 ±0.12, 2.10 ±0.11), and IL-6 levels (B: 697.24 ±47.62, 654.35 ±37.21; C: 662. 63 ±45.67,612. 54 ±39. 72) were lower (P〈0. 01 ) in groups B and C. There was no statistically significant difference in MDA and SOD levels between group B and group C ( P 〉 0.05 ). The CRP and IL-6 levels were significantly improved in group C as compared with group B ( P 〈 0. 05 ). Conclusion Fangji-Huangqi decoction can obviously alleviate lung IRI in rabbits probably by antioxidation, removal of oxygen radicals and reduction of systemic inflammatory response.
